❓ Frequently asked questions about Le Sel-de-Bretagne

What is the price per m² in Le Sel-de-Bretagne?

The median price per m² in Le Sel-de-Bretagne is 1 960 €.

What is the rental yield in Le Sel-de-Bretagne?

The gross rental yield in Le Sel-de-Bretagne is 5.3%.

Is Le Sel-de-Bretagne a good real estate investment?

Le Sel-de-Bretagne has a ScorCity score of 41/100, making it a moderate investment.

What is the average energy rating in Le Sel-de-Bretagne?

The most common energy rating class in Le Sel-de-Bretagne is D.
